Les polices PostScript Type 1 ont été développées par Adobe Systems pour les imprimantes PostScript.
Les polices PostScript Type 1 sont des polices vectorielles. Elles décrivent les formes des lettres, ou "glyphes", à partir de lignes et de courbes de Bézier cubiques. Un "glyphe" est la forme typographique utilisée pour représenter un code de caractère à l'écran ou sur papier. Exemples de glyphes, les lettres de l'alphabet ou les symboles d'une police telle que ITC ZapfDingbats (
).
Les polices Type 1 présentent les caractéristiques suivantes :
- Leurs fichiers sont plus petits que ceux des polices TrueType ; elles occupent donc moins de place sur le disque dur de votre système.
- Étant vectorielles, les polices Type 1 sont redimensionnables jusqu'à pratiquement n'importe quel corps. Elles restent nettes et lisses sur n'importe quelle plate-forme, et leur lisibilité reste bonne même imprimées en petit corps sur une imprimante laser basse résolution.
- Les polices PostScript Type 1 sont généralement utilisées par les professionnels de l'édition. Elles sont reconnues par la plupart des périphériques de sortie haut de gamme, dont le langage de description de page est généralement PostScript.
- Une police PostScript Type 1 consiste en deux fichiers séparés. L'un contient les contours vectoriels des caractères et l'autre les données métriques. Dans Microsoft Windows, elles se reconnaissent à leurs extensions : *.pfb (Printer Font Binary) pour les contours et *.pfm (Printer Font Metrics) pour les métriques. Le premier type de fichier (.pfb) est généralement appelé la police d'imprimante et le second (.pfm) la police d'écran. La taille combinée des deux fichiers reste encore inférieure à celle de la police TrueType équivalente. Une police PostScript peut ainsi ne représenter que la moitié de la taille de la police TrueType correspondante.
- Une police PostScript Type 1 se reconnaît aux icônes suivantes :
| Icône |
Description |
 |
Police PostScript Type 1 sous Microsoft Windows |
 |
Police PostScript Type 1 sous Mac OS |